最新亚洲中文av在线不卡-人妻少妇一区二区三区-青青草无码精品伊人久久-a国产一区二区免费入口-久久www免费人成人片

您好,歡迎訪問通商軟件官方網站!
24小時免費咨詢熱線: 400-1611-009
聯系我們 | 加入合作

判斷大于100且小于50的數據時,IF函數返回異常,怎么排查?

ERP系統 & MES 生產管理系統

10萬用戶實施案例,ERP 系統實現微信、銷售、庫存、生產、財務、人資、辦公等一體化管理

在使用IF函數進行條件判斷時,常常會遇到一些意外的錯誤,尤其是在進行大于100且小于50的判斷時。IF函數是Excel和其他表格工具中常用的函數,它通過判斷給定的條件是否成立,然后返回指定的值。如果條件滿足,返回一個結果;如果條件不滿足,則返回另一個結果。但有時,在處理范圍較大的條件時,我們可能會遇到異常情況,導致結果不符合預期。本篇文章將詳細分析IF函數在判斷大于100且小于50時返回異常的原因,并探討解決這一問題的有效方法,幫助用戶避免常見的錯誤,并提高數據處理的準確性和效率。

一、IF函數的基本結構

在討論IF函數的異常問題之前,我們首先要了解IF函數的基本使用方法。IF函數的語法非常簡單,通常為:

`=IF(條件, 值_if_真, 值_if_假)`

其中,條件是我們要判斷的邏輯表達式,值_if_真是當條件成立時返回的結果,值_if_假是當條件不成立時返回的結果。舉例來說,假設我們要判斷某個數值是否大于100:

`=IF(A1>100, “大于100”, “不大于100”)`

如果A1單元格的值大于100,則返回“大于100”,否則返回“不大于100”。

二、判斷大于100且小于50的IF函數問題分析

當我們需要判斷某個數值是否大于100且小于50時,邏輯上就會產生一些矛盾。因為一個數值不可能同時大于100和小于50。這種情況會導致IF函數的條件判斷失效,無法返回預期的結果。

例如,假設我們寫下以下公式:

`=IF(A1>100 AND A1<50, "符合條件", "不符合條件")`

這條公式的意圖是判斷A1是否大于100且小于50,但實際上這兩個條件永遠無法同時成立。因此,函數將返回“不符合條件”,這雖然是正確的,但如果用戶期望看到具體的錯誤提示或調試信息,可能會感到困惑。

三、常見的錯誤和排查方法

1. 邏輯矛盾

最常見的錯誤就是條件邏輯上存在矛盾。由于數值不可能同時滿足大于100和小于50,因此IF函數會返回錯誤的判斷結果。在此類問題中,首先要確認條件是否符合實際需求,避免將無法同時成立的條件放在一起。

2. 邏輯運算符使用不當

另一種常見錯誤是使用不正確的邏輯運算符。在Excel中,使用`AND`和`OR`運算符可以組合多個條件。如果你希望判斷數值是否大于100或者小于50,可以使用`OR`運算符,而不是`AND`。例如:

`=IF(OR(A1>100, A1<50), "符合條件", "不符合條件")`

這樣,公式會判斷A1是否滿足“>100”或“<50”的任意條件,避免了邏輯矛盾。

3. 使用“IF”時未處理特殊情況

在很多情況下,我們并不僅僅需要返回一個“符合”或“不符合”的簡單值,而是需要對數據進行更深入的處理。例如,如果數據為空或非數字,IF函數可能會返回錯誤結果。此時可以使用`ISNUMBER`函數來判斷數據是否為有效數字:

`=IF(ISNUMBER(A1), IF(OR(A1>100, A1<50), "符合條件", "不符合條件"), "數據無效")`

這段代碼首先檢查A1是否為數字,如果是,則繼續判斷其是否大于100或小于50;如果不是數字,則返回“數據無效”的提示。

四、如何優化IF函數的應用

為了使IF函數更加高效和準確,我們可以采取以下幾種優化措施:

1. 分步判斷

當條件比較復雜時,可以將判斷過程分步進行。例如,可以先判斷數值是否大于100,再判斷是否小于50。將復雜的條件分解成簡單的步驟,避免邏輯錯誤。

示例:

`=IF(A1>100, “大于100”, IF(A1<50, "小于50", "其他"))`

通過分步判斷,公式更加簡潔明了,且易于調試和維護。

2. 使用嵌套IF函數

當需要進行多條件判斷時,可以通過嵌套多個IF函數來處理不同的情況。例如,判斷一個數值是否在100至200之間,或者是否小于50等:

`=IF(A1>100, IF(A1<200, "在100到200之間", "大于200"), "小于等于100")`

通過嵌套IF函數,可以處理多個條件的判斷。

3. 使用其他函數配合IF函數

除了`AND`和`OR`,還可以使用`IFERROR`、`ISBLANK`、`ISNUMBER`等函數來進一步提高公式的健壯性。例如,處理除法時可能出現的除零錯誤,可以使用`IFERROR`函數:

`=IFERROR(A1/B1, “除數為零”)`

這種方法可以避免因除零導致的錯誤,保證函數返回有意義的結果。

五、總結

在使用IF函數進行復雜條件判斷時,可能會遇到一些常見的錯誤,如邏輯矛盾、運算符使用不當等。尤其是判斷條件之間存在沖突時(例如大于100且小于50),會導致IF函數無法返回預期結果。通過分步判斷、合理運用邏輯運算符、避免不可能同時成立的條件,可以有效解決這些問題。同時,使用`ISNUMBER`、`IFERROR`等函數可以提高公式的穩定性和健壯性,從而避免一些常見的錯誤。

在進行數據處理時,合理使用IF函數能夠極大地提高工作效率,但必須注意公式的設計與邏輯,避免出現不必要的錯誤。通過以上的分析與優化技巧,相信你能夠更加熟練地運用IF函數,提升工作中的數據處理能力。

在線疑問仍未解決?專業顧問為您一對一講解

24小時人工在線已服務6865位顧客5分鐘內回復

Scroll to top
咨詢電話
客服郵箱
主站蜘蛛池模板: 伊人久久精品在热线热| 少女韩国电视剧在线观看完整 | 久久精品一区二区av999| 久久精品国产精油按摩| 亚洲精品色情app在线下载观看| 国产成人无码aⅴ片在线观看导航 18禁成年无码免费网站无遮挡 | 小婷又软又嫩又紧水又多的视频| 欧美激情一区二区三区高清视频| 国产乱子伦在线一区二区| 国产精品人妻一区二区高| 天堂va蜜桃一区二区三区| 综合激情五月丁香久久| 国模精品一区二区三区| 国内精品自线在拍2020不卡| 亚洲国产成人va在线观看天堂| 国产欧美日韩在线在线播放| 免费观看又色又爽又湿的视频| 国产成人片无码免费视频软件| 免费体验区试看120秒| 国产乱子夫妻xx黑人xyx真爽| 688欧美人禽杂交狂配| 日韩精品一区二区三区| 精品亚洲成a人无码成a在线观看| 在线精品视频一区二区三区| 亚洲成在人网站av天堂| 亚洲色无码国产精品网站可下载| 日韩好精品视频你懂的| 国产青草视频在线观看| 国产精品视频色尤物yw| 久久天天躁狠狠躁夜夜av浪潮 | 亚洲伊人一本大道中文字幕| 99精品国产在热久久婷婷 | 精品国精品无码自拍自在线| 亚洲男人av天堂男人社区| 亚洲精品国产高清在线观看| 无码av一区在线观看免费| 国产肉体xxxx裸体137大胆| 无码视频在线播放| 日韩欧美亚洲国产精品字幕久久久 | 中文字字幕在线中文无码| 又大又粗弄得我出好多水|